Open the catalog to page 1WORKING PRINCIPLE The reed switch relies on two basic scientific principles namely: buoyancy and magnetism. Buoyancy causes the float (which contains a magnet) to rise with the liquid and magnetism helps open and close the switch. A change in liquid levels raises or lowers the float up or down. The end of the pivot arm (non float side) contains a permanent magnet that can repel the switch magnet (inside the stationary ‘stem’ of the entire structure). The side mounted float level sensor (FF series) are manufactured specifically for horizontal mounting on tanks or vessels. They work well as high...

Open the catalog to page 111. SUS304/SUS316 materials are not available for corrosive application. 2. The cable duct(s) must face downward to prevent moisture seeping in. 3. The float and extension rod must be inserted into the bin completely. 4. Check the liquid's S.G. level before installation. 5. The mounting hole must be larger than the external diameter of the float. (Please refer to p2) 6. Don't mount the devices near the bin's inlet or outlet.
